Yukitaka Izumi (Japanese: (いずみ) 行高 (ゆきたか) Izumi Yukitaka) is Hinata's former classmate from Yukigaoka Junior High. He was originally on the basketball team but played on the volleyball team so Hinata could have enough members to go to the competition.

Appearance

He has messy, light auburn hair, brown eyes, and freckles. He also has a small build.

Personality

He has a gentle personality and often looks out for Hinata, encouraging his friend whenever he's down.

Background

Izumi went to Yukigaoka Junior High with Hinata and Kōji before graduating to an unknown high school. In his third year of junior high, he and Kōji joined the boys' volleyball club as temporary members so the team could attend the Junior High Athletics Meet. However, they were shocked when their first opponent turned out to be the champion school Kitagawa Daiichi. Despite this, Izumi tried hard during the match to give Hinata good tosses, but he messed up towards the end. Yukigaoka was completely annihilated by Kitagawa Daiichi[1].

Plot

Izumi makes his debut when he is riding his bike through town with Hinata and telling his friend to stop watching the Spring Tournament on tv or else they would lose their field to play sports. Although he normally plays basketball, Izumi agreed to join Hinata's volleyball team so he would have enough players to play in the tournament and was tasked with playing the setter. Like the rest of the team, Izumi became terrified once they learned they would be facing Kitagawa Daiichi Junior High in their first match.

During the game, Izumi tried to get the ball up as best as he could but he would occasionally be riddled with nerves. When Kitagawa was at match point, his nerves became so great that he unintentionally sent the set in the wrong direction. Despite this, Hinata was able to move fast enough to reach the set. Izumi and Kōji did their best to comfort Hinata after the match but Hinata would instead voice his gratitude once more for them helping him to play in a real match.

Spring High Preliminary Arc

Izumi and Kōji greet Hinata.

Izumi and Kōji plan to go see Karasuno's match against Shiratorizawa together[2]. When Karasuno arrives at the arena, the two approach Hinata, who's surprised and thrilled about their presence. Hinata introduces them to Tanaka and the two sheepishly admit the sports teams they were on originally. Suddenly, Kōji notices Kageyama and angrily asks Hinata why he's there. Jokingly, Hinata explains the changes Kageyama had gone through before the latter calls him away. After Hinata leaves, Izumi and Kōji admit to each other how when they text, they never ask Hinata about how he's been and weren't expecting to see him now with a complete team.

When they go to the bleachers to cheer on Karasuno, they're overwhelmed by Shiratorizawa's larger cheering squad. They are also disappointed by Karasuno when the members make fools of themselves. Izumi comments on it, much to Shimada and Takinoue's embarrassment.

As the match begins, the two worry about Hinata and wonder if he has to go to the bathroom one more time. Karasuno is overwhelmed by Shiratorizawa at first so the two loudly encourage the members. Throughout the match, they comment on Hinata's improvements. The two join in when Saeko starts a cheer for the team[3].

After the match ends in Karasuno's victory[4], the two go outside to congratulate Hinata and Kageyama before Ushijima interrupts them. After he challenges Hinata to defeat him next time, a shocked Izumi wonders about Hinata's influence with other volleyball players.

Tokyo Nationals Arc

Izumi and Kōji are seen watching Karasuno's match against Kamomedai and show to be concerned when Hinata collapsed[5].

Final Arc

Izumi and Kōji attend the match between the MSBY Black Jackals and the Schweiden Adlers to support Hinata. At the time of the match, Izumi is a college senior.

Statistics

Originally a basketball player, Izumi is not very familiar with volleyball and what is required of being a setter. Like the rest of the Yukigaoka Junior High team, Izumi relies on Hinata to tell him what to do. Being faced against the taller and more intimidating players of Kitagawa Daiichi Junior High, Izumi easily succumbed to the nerves of playing in the match and would give poor sets. Despite this, he still did the best he could to help Hinata.

Relationships

Shōyō Hinata

They are close friends, and Izumi would toss to Hinata, albeit reluctantly, whenever he was free. Izumi did join his team temporarily with Kōji though. When the game ended and Hinata thanked the two of them, Izumi started crying. They still keep in touch through text, but Hinata never really talks about himself. Along with Kōji, Izumi attended Karasuno's match against Shiratorizawa and was also present for Hinata's debut game between the Adlers and Jackals. 

Kōji Sekimukai

They are close friends and attended the same junior high. In their third year, they supported Hinata by joining his team together and helped each other with volleyball terms during the match. Even after graduating from junior high, they keep in touch through text and even planned together to attend Karasuno's match against Shiratorizawa.
